ABSTRACT:
A mounting part (14) for a surface mount connector (11) to be mounted on a board (16) which includes a substantially L-shaped body having a vertical section (21) and a horizontal section (20); and a stepped opening (18) or soldering tongue (52) formed on the horizontal section for increasing an attachment strength between the mounting part and the board.
